K.O.D.

K.O.D., or the Committee for the Defense of Disco, is Pitti Schitti and Kovvalsky. Two friends in life and behind the decks, who explore together disco classics, experimental italo, house straight out of Paradise Garage, electro, techno and everything in between, as well as the unexpected music appearing out of who knows where. With such a selection they have toured Poland and the world, which should come as no surprise, because the warmth and joy that beams from their music are contagious!

KAMP!

Kamp! have been present on the Polish scene for a decade and a half and have been evolving stylistically since their debut in 2007, drawing inspiration from both 80s electronic pop and 90s club music. They recently announced the end of their activity and, as part of their farewell tour, could not fail to visit Plock and Audioriver. Their return to the Riviera promises to be a unique farewell, during which a tear might be shed every now and then to every emotional song.

KANINE

Kanine is one of the biggest stars of the young drum & bass generation. He delights with his productions and original bootlegs, which are already hard to count at this point, as well as his intense, unrelenting sets. The artist was named the best newcomer at the Drum&BassArena Awards in 2019 and has been pushing his way up the scene ever since, releasing dozens of singles and not closing himself off to the d&b subgenre, boldly entering dancefloor strains and jump-up, but he can also surprise with some liquid.
